Transaction 2e1524becb39d03734c7203dbd507c1f99027e2b44667f62372f2407f485a4f5

6 Input
2 Outputs
  • 2e1524becb39d03734c7203dbd507c1f99027e2b44667f62372f2407f485a4f5:0
  • value  1225655
    address  17pVmimEuPczEeL6gqKLvf4yDLFbADNHeh
  • 2e1524becb39d03734c7203dbd507c1f99027e2b44667f62372f2407f485a4f5:1
  • value  1000027
    address  115b6EzHPGFThzY8rGgj5hQLnX6HGJu1ts